Businesses which have gone public are subject to laws concerning their inside governance, similar to how govt officers' compensation is set, and when and how information is disclosed to shareholders and to the public. In the United States, these rules are primarily applied and enforced by the United States Securities and Exchange Commission . The laws are applied and enforced by the China Securities Regulation Commission in China. In Singapore, the regulatory authority is the Monetary Authority of Singapore , and in Hong Kong, it's the Securities and Futures Commission .

A very detailed and well-established physique of guidelines that developed over a really long time period applies to commercial transactions. The want to regulate commerce and commerce and resolve enterprise disputes helped shape the creation of regulation and courts. The Code of Hammurabi dates back to about 1772 BC for example and incorporates provisions that relate, among other matters, to delivery costs and dealings between merchants and brokers.

Accounting is the measurement, processing, and communication of financial details about economic entities corresponding to companies and firms. The modern area was established by the Italian mathematician Luca Pacioli in 1494. Accounting, which has been known as the "language of business", measures the results of a corporation's economic activities and conveys this data to a selection of customers, together with traders, collectors, management, and regulators. The phrases "accounting" and "financial reporting" are often used as synonyms.

Many businesses are operated via a separate entity such as a company or a partnership . Most authorized jurisdictions permit folks to organize such an entity by filing sure charter documents with the related Secretary of State or equal and complying with sure other ongoing obligations. The relationships and legal rights of shareholders, restricted companions, or members are ruled partly by the charter documents and partly by the legislation of the jurisdiction the place the entity is organized. Generally talking, shareholders in a corporation, restricted partners in a restricted partnership, and members in a limited legal responsibility company are shielded from personal liability for the money owed and obligations of the entity, which is legally handled as a separate "person". This signifies that unless there is misconduct, the proprietor's personal possessions are strongly protected in legislation if the business doesn't succeed. The commerce union, via its leadership, bargains with the employer on behalf of union members and negotiates labor contracts with employers. The commonest function of those associations or unions is "sustaining or enhancing the situations of their employment". This may embody the negotiation of wages, work guidelines, criticism procedures, guidelines governing hiring, firing, and promotion of employees, advantages, office safety and insurance policies.
